An Integrated Optical Module Switch, often realized through Co-Packaged Optics (CPO), combines optical modules and switch ASICs in a single package to dramatically improve speed, efficiency, and reliability in high-performance networks.Overview of Integrated Optical Module SwitchesIntegrated optical module switches, particularly those using CPO technology, integrate the optical transceivers responsible for transmitting and receiving light signals directly with the switch ASIC that processes electrical signals . Unlike traditional pluggable optical modules, which require long electrical traces from the ASIC to the external transceiver, CPO places optical components in close proximity to the ASIC, often achieving millimeter-level electrical connections through silicon photonics interfaces . This integration reduces signal loss, power consumption, and latency while improving overall link efficiency.Key AdvantagesReduced Power Loss and Consumption: Traditional architectures can lose up to 22 dB per 200 Gb/s channel and consume up to 30W per interface. CPO significantly lowers these losses and power requirements .Improved Signal Integrity: Shorter electrical paths reduce the risk of signal degradation, enabling higher data rates and longer effective transmission distances .Enhanced Network Resiliency: Integrated designs provide up to 10x higher network resiliency and 5x better power efficiency, which is critical for large-scale AI clusters .Space Efficiency: By eliminating the need for separate pluggable modules, CPO frees up valuable front-panel space in data center switches .ApplicationsIntegrated optical module switches are particularly suited for high-bandwidth, low-latency environments, including:AI and machine learning clusters requiring 400G/800G/1.6T Ethernet or InfiniBand connectivity .Hyperscale data centers where power efficiency and thermal management are critical .Next-generation networking platforms, such as NVIDIA Spectrum-X™ Ethernet and Quantum-X800 InfiniBand, which leverage silicon photonics for co-packaged optics .Challenges and ConsiderationsDespite their advantages, CPO switches have some limitations:Reduced Configurability: All ports typically use the same optics type, limiting flexibility .Serviceability: Embedded optical modules are harder to inspect or replace, and a failed port can reduce switch throughput .Vendor Interoperability: Integrating optics and ASICs tightly may create challenges when mixing components from different vendors .Industry AdoptionCPO technology is increasingly adopted by leading data center operators and AI infrastructure providers, including Texas Advanced Computing Center, CoreWeave, and Lambda, due to its efficiency and performance benefits . While some experts still advocate for alternatives like Linear Pluggable Optics (LPOs) for certain use cases, the trend toward co-packaged optics is accelerating, especially for high-speed, high-density networking environments . In summary, Integrated Optical Module Switches using CPO technology represent a transformative approach to data center networking, offering significant improvements in power efficiency, signal integrity, and scalability, while also introducing new considerations for serviceability and interoperability.
